What Buyers Really Want: How to Win More NHS Public Sector Business

This webinar is designed for suppliers looking to grow and strengthen their presence within the NHS and wider public sector market. Whether you represent a multinational healthcare organisation, a growing SME, or a specialist service provider, success increasingly depends on understanding how buyers assess opportunities, evaluate suppliers, and build long-term partnerships.

For many suppliers, the challenge is not simply finding opportunities but understanding what truly influences buying decisions. What differentiates one supplier from another? What do procurement and supply chain leaders value most? How can organisations position themselves as trusted partners rather than just another bidder?

This webinar provides a unique opportunity to hear directly from a senior NHS supply chain leader who makes these decisions every day. Attendees will gain practical insights into buyer expectations, common supplier pitfalls, how supplier relationships are evaluated, and the steps organisations can take to improve their chances of winning and retaining business.

About our guest speaker

Jaymin Shah is Director of Supply Chain at KFM Healthcare, one of the UK’s leading NHS-aligned healthcare support organisations. With more than 20 years of experience across both the NHS and private healthcare sectors, Jaymin brings a unique perspective on what drives successful buyer-supplier relationships.

Having worked on both sides of the procurement process, he understands the commercial objectives suppliers are trying to achieve while also recognising the challenges, pressures and priorities facing today’s healthcare buyers. His experience provides an invaluable view into how suppliers can better align their approach, demonstrate value, and build stronger relationships in an increasingly competitive and evolving market.
